The Pitch:
The LIFESAVER bottle allows anyone to provide safe sterile drinking water for themselves and the family. It will produce up to 6000 litres of sterile drinking water. Given mass production it would cost just $0.5c per day to operate. And for only $20 billion the whole world could have safe sterile drinking water. 3.5 billion people would cease suffering from diarrhoea every year and 2 million more children would live. A small price for such a massive return.
Water is weight! Delivering it even short distances is time consuming and expensive and is an unnecessarily damaging contributor to global warming. It requires long logistic chains to maintain supplies. This problem is acutely evident during disasters and military operations. A study by the US Department of Defence shows the cost of delivering bottled water to Afghanistan at $4.69 per gallon. Hurricane Mitch costs were even higher with figures from the Pentagon showing the air freight cost at $7.60 a gallon.
A Boeing C-17 Globemaster III transport plane has a maximum payload for 72,000 litres (19,020 gallons) of water. Enough water to last 800 people 30 days at a cost of $144,000. An estimated 125,000 LIFESAVER bottles fit in the same payload. In a household of 4 people that is enough LIFESAVER bottles to provide 500,000 people with safe drinking water for up to 16 months at a cost of only $18m. It would take 9,375 C-17 shipments do deliver the same quantity of water at a cost of $835 million .
Put another way over a 60 day period shipping bottled water would cost $6 per person per day while providing LIFESAVER bottles the cost would be just $0.60c per person per day. Over the 16 months the cost would drop to $0.07c per person per day.
LIFESAVER bottle will have a significant impact on humanitarian and disaster relief operations world-wide. It’s unique technology now means local sources of water may be safely drunk. Importantly LIFESAVER bottle will reduce the onset and spread of diseases and reduce the logistical supported required when responding to events and humanitarian relief missions.
LIFESAVER lowers the overall cost of response by up to 70% as in many cases no bottled water will be required. Less medicine, staff and transportation are needed. Environmentally no landfill sites have to be created to dispose of the millions of waste plastic bottles and the CO2 footprint left after shipping LIFESAVER vs. bottled water is negligible.
LIFESAVER bottle will save lives. In future, deploying LIFESAVER bottles to emergency situations such as the recent flooding in the Bangladesh and the hurricanes in the USA will result in more lives being saved. There will less cost, less environmental impact and faster responses than were ever possible before.
